Researchers confirm what American parents already know: The economy can't recover as long as day cares and schools remain closed

are at high risk of dropping out of the labor force altogether to raise children without proper childcare options. At some point, there's a struggle to both a parent and a worker.

The women who commit to juggling both could see their earnings potential and work opportunities dwindle as a result, according to The"We could have an entire generation of women who are hurt," Betsey Stevenson, an economics professor at the University of Michigan, told the Times. Some women "may spend a significant amount of time out of the work force," Stevenson said, implying a difficult return, "or their careers could just peter out in terms of promotions."Do you have a personal experience with the coronavirus you'd like to share?
